Why Live in Santa Fe Springs
Santa Fe Springs, CA, is a small community known for its industrial roots and suburban charm. Located about 15 miles from downtown Los Angeles, it is part of the Gateway Cities, making it ideal for commuters. The residential area on the east side features midcentury ranch-style homes and Mediterranean townhouses, with streets lined with magnolia trees and landscaped yards. Heritage Park, a historical site with gardens, a museum, and cultural events, is a popular attraction. Little Lake Park offers batting cages and a pool, while Santa Fe Springs Park provides playgrounds and access to the San Gabriel River Mid Trail. The city is served by the Whittier Union High School District, which has high ratings. Retail options include Santa Fe Springs Promenade and Santa Fe Springs Marketplace, with various stores and dining choices. The Hathaway Ranch Museum showcases the area's farming and oil history. Annual events like the Tree Lighting Ceremony and the Santa Fe Springs Swap Meet add to the local culture. Public transportation includes Metrolink trains and Metro buses, with Long Beach Airport 15 miles away. The community experiences warm and cool wet seasons, with significant heat and air quality risks during summer.
Home Trends in Santa Fe Springs, CA
On average, homes in Santa Fe Springs, CA sell after 29 days on the market compared to the national average of 51 days. The median sale price for homes in Santa Fe Springs, CA over the last 12 months is $768,484, up 2% from the median home sale price over the previous 12 months.
